The City of Carlyle had a population of 3,340 as of July 1, 2017.
The primary coordinate point for Carlyle is located at latitude 38.6223 and longitude -89.3754 in Clinton County. The formal boundaries for the City of Carlyle (see map below) encompass a land area of 3.39 sq. miles and a water area of 0 sq. miles. Clinton County is in the Central time zone (GMT -6). The elevation is 456 feet.
The City of Carlyle (GNIS ID: 2393749) has a C1 Census Class Code which indicates an active incorporated place that does not serve as a county subdivision equivalent. It also has a Functional Status Code of "A" which identifies an active government providing primary general-purpose functions.
The City of Carlyle is located within Township of Carlyle, a minor civil division (MCD) of Clinton County.

Alternate Unofficial Names for Carlyle: Carlisle, Fredonia.
